A new report by the International Food Policy Research Institute reflects on the concept and measurement of women’s empowerment and reviews some of the structural interventions that aim to influence underlying gender norms in society and eradicate gender discrimination. The report then proceeds to review the evidence of the impact of three types of interventions—cash transfer programs, agricultural interventions, and microfinance programs—on women’s empowerment, nutrition, or both.  The paper ends with a discussion of the findings and remaining evidence gaps as well as an outline of recommendations for research.
